About 38 Lime Tree Crescent
38 Lime Tree Crescent is a semi-detached house in New Rossington, Doncaster, Doncaster (DN11 0BT). It has a recorded floor area of 84 m² (around 904 sq ft), construction records dating it to 1950-1966 and council tax band A. The latest certificate (July 2020) shows a C (score 71). When first surveyed in March 2015 the rating was D, the property has climbed 1 band since. Between certificates, wall efficiency went from Very Poor to Good; while roof efficiency dropped from Very Good to Good. The recommended improvements would push it to B (score 85).
It changed hands recently, sold January 2025 for £120,000. Across 2020–2025, sale prices on this property compounded at 3.3% per year. Today's modelled estimate of £150,000 is 25% above the 2025 sale price. On a £-per-square-foot basis, the last sale (£133/sq ft) was about 44.1% above the typical sold price in the postcode.
